A prominent leaker has taken to social media to share new images of Fortnite's upcoming Chapter 6 Season 1 map. The battle royale recently brought Chapter 5 to a close with a Marvel-themed season. This was the game's second season-wide collaboration with Marvel and took place in the wake of Disney investing 1.5 billion dollars in an equity stake of Epic Games. As the partnership between Disney and Epic Games has deepened, many fans have been eager to see what's on the horizon for Fortnite. It has been nearly one year since the game expanded its presence by introducing new modes like Fortnite Festival, LEGO Fortnite, and Rocket Racing.
Fortnite will soon end its latest season, Chapter 2 Remix. The short throwback season featured the return of an old map, a mini-battle pass, unvaulted weapons, and even the game's forgotten shakedown mechanic. While many returning elements were familiar to players, old locations were remixed to incorporate new collaborations with Snoop Dogg, Ice Spice, Eminem, and Juice WRLD. Players have even been able to earn free Juice WRLD cosmetics in Fortnite for a limited time. The season has been a celebration of the game's past while fans eagerly await the release of Chapter 6 Season 1 in December.

Prominent leaker ShiinaBR posted an image of Fortnite's Chapter 6 Season 1 map on Twitter just after the game's Chapter 2 Remix finale event. The upcoming season features many Japanese themes, and the colorful top-down view of the map seems to reflect this. The map appears to be devoid of the large desert areas that made up so much of the game's Chapter 5 landscape. While it's difficult to discern too many specific details from the image, fans can look forward to seeing Godzilla stomp around Fortnite's map very soon.
The newest season of Fortnite seems as if it will hit the ground running. Shortly after the update's release, the game will be debuting a new way to play called Fortnite OG. The game mode will bring back the battle royale's Chapter 1 map and feature its own battle pass. Around the same time, Fortnite will be crossing over with Marvel Rivals. Players will have the opportunity to claim a free cosmetic in Fortnite when they play ten matches of Marvel's new team-based hero shooter.
Chapter 6 looks as if it will be full of surprises for new and returning players alike. In fact, one of the game's latest trailers showed fans that the newest season of Fortnite will include a form of wall-running. While trailers, leaks, and rumors have the community abuzz, it's likely Epic Games has managed to keep a few big secrets to themselves. Fans won't have to wait long, as Chapter 6 Season 1 launches on December 1, 2024.
